What Is Methyllithium?
Methyllithium is an organometallic compound consisting of a methyl group bonded to lithium. It is commonly supplied as a solution in hydrocarbon solvents and is widely recognized for its strong basic and nucleophilic properties.
Due to its high reactivity, Methyllithium is frequently used in organic synthesis to form carbon-carbon bonds, generate reactive intermediates, and facilitate complex chemical transformations. Its unique characteristics make it an indispensable reagent in numerous industrial applications.

Carbon-Carbon Bond Formation
One of the most valuable industrial applications of Methyllithium is its ability to facilitate carbon-carbon bond formation.
Carbon-carbon bond formation is a fundamental process in organic chemistry because it allows chemists to construct increasingly complex molecules from simpler building blocks.
Methyllithium is commonly used in reactions involving:
Ketones
Aldehydes
Esters
Acid chlorides
Various organic substrates
These reactions help manufacturers create key intermediates used in pharmaceuticals, agrochemicals, and specialty chemicals.
The efficiency of Methyllithium in forming carbon-carbon bonds makes it a preferred reagent for industrial synthesis operations.
